Overview
The properties that define an email domain. An email domain contains configuration used to assert responsibility for emails sent from that domain.
Constant Summary collapse
- LIFECYCLE_STATE_ENUM =
[ LIFECYCLE_STATE_ACTIVE = 'ACTIVE'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_CREATING = 'CREATING'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_DELETING = 'DELETING'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_DELETED = 'DELETED'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_FAILED = 'FAILED'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_UPDATING = 'UPDATING'.freeze, LIFECYCLE_STATE_UNKNOWN_ENUM_VALUE = 'UNKNOWN_ENUM_VALUE'.freeze ].freeze
- DOMAIN_VERIFICATION_STATUS_ENUM =
[ DOMAIN_VERIFICATION_STATUS_NONE = 'NONE'.freeze, DOMAIN_VERIFICATION_STATUS_DOMAINID = 'DOMAINID'.freeze, DOMAIN_VERIFICATION_STATUS_OTHER = 'OTHER'.freeze, DOMAIN_VERIFICATION_STATUS_UNKNOWN_ENUM_VALUE = 'UNKNOWN_ENUM_VALUE'.freeze ].freeze
Instance Attribute Summary collapse
-
#active_dkim_id ⇒ String
The OCID of the DKIM key that will be used to sign mail sent from this email domain.
-
#compartment_id ⇒ String
The OCID of the compartment that contains this email domain.
-
#defined_tags ⇒ Hash<String, Hash<String, Object>>
Defined tags for this resource.
-
#description ⇒ String
The description of an email domain.
-
#domain_verification_id ⇒ String
Id for Domain in Domain Management (under governance) if DOMAINID verification method used.
-
#domain_verification_status ⇒ String
The current domain verification status.
-
#freeform_tags ⇒ Hash<String, String>
Free-form tags for this resource.
-
#id ⇒ String
[Required] The OCID of the email domain.
-
#is_spf ⇒ BOOLEAN
Value of the SPF field.
-
#lifecycle_state ⇒ String
The current state of the email domain.
-
#locks ⇒ Array<OCI::Email::Models::ResourceLock>
Locks associated with this resource.
-
#name ⇒ String
[Required] The name of the email domain in the Internet Domain Name System (DNS).
-
#system_tags ⇒ Hash<String, Hash<String, Object>>
Usage of system tag keys.
-
#time_created ⇒ DateTime
The time the email domain was created, expressed in RFC 3339 timestamp format, "YYYY-MM-ddThh:mmZ".
